Default How do I keep the zeros in front of numbers when i split a cell

I am splitting a cell in the cell is dix00001
I need to split it from the first three letters, and when I do I get dix in
one cell and a 1 in the second cell and I need 00001 in the xecond cell. I
have tried formatting the column to text and general.
